Nike and Hyperice unveil first-ever recovery slide with built-in heat and vibration recovery

nike-air-zoom-hyperslide.jpg


Recovery is paramount for any athlete to be great at their craft, but Nike and Hyperice created yet another footwear innovation designed to help those hard-working athletes unwind from the ground up.

This time, it’s with a slip-on slide.

The Nike Air Zoom Hyperslide was introduced on Monday as the latest innovation developed in partnership with Hyperice, the health technology company that designs products specifically for recovery.

By combining Nike’s footwear expertise with Hyperice’s recovery technology, and building off the foundation of the award-winning Nike x Hyperice Hyperboot, this slide is designed to be wearable no matter the time of day, but with recovery in mind.

How exactly can a slide help an athlete recover just by wearing it? A magnetic Hyperslide Pod housed inside the slide’s adjustable strap delivers three levels of heat as well as three levels of vibration that run within 15-minute cycles. This gives athletes the ability to seamlessly customize how they want to experience the slide’s recovery features through on-pod controls, or simply using the Hyperice App.

And whether it’s before or after competitions, training or regular life moments, the slide is a low-profile, full-length Air Zoom sole for soft, responsive comfort with targeted Hyperice heat and vibration within.

"Athletes leave everything on the field, and the approach to recovery needs to meet them at the same level," Tobi Hatfield, senior director of athlete innovation at Nike, said in a statement. "With the Nike Air Zoom Hyperslide, we wanted to create a solution that kickstarts recovery the moment you power it up — helping athletes feel more relaxed, restored and ready to take their performance to the next level."

Nike and Hyperice got feedback on the product from a range of athletes, pro and everyday performers, including Netherlands and Liverpool star Virgil van Dijk.

"It’s the combination that stands out," he said in a press release. "The Hyperice heat and vibration help my feet recover as quickly as possible, while the Nike Air Zoom cushioning makes it feel incredibly comfortable."

It also helps that Nike and Hyperice understood what athletes need to recover and how to use their respective expertise to make it happen after feedback from the Hyperboot. That product was tested with Nike Olympians at the 2024 Paris Summer Games, and it went on to exceed $10 million in revenue in its first eight months.

It was the first shoe ever carried by Best Buy, while also winning numerous innovation awards.

The Air Zoom Hyperslide reflects both companies’ belief that performance doesn’t just end when competition or training stops. Athletes are always looking for an edge over the competition, and recovery has seen an uptick in priority to ensure a fresh mind and body for the next day, no matter what’s on the docket.

"Our partnership with Nike has always been driven by a shared commitment to innovation for the athlete," Hyperice founder Anthony Katz said in a statement. "With the Nike Air Zoom Hyperslide, we’re making premium recovery more accessible than ever, combining Nike’s iconic footwear expertise with Hyperice technology to help people recover smarter with every step."

The Air Zoom Hyperslide will be made available beginning Sept. 29 in select markets.
